Our Street Railway
Matters n regard to the street railway are beginning to move. The city engineer's survoy has been made and accepted by the company, and the directors are now busy receiving bids for the building of the rcad. Oa Friday, K. P. Peet superintendent, and Robert Smith, eecretary, of the company, came down from Ithaca and met the representative of a New York firm of contractors, who put in bid for building the road. On Saturday. Geo. Moan, of the R b;nson & Moao Co., street car and railwy builders, of Chicago, III , and Watcrloo, Iowa, was in the city. He went over the proposed line and submitted a bid lor constructing it. Wo-k on the line will begin ehrly in the sprine.
